SST Announces Production of Small-Footprint, High-Performance
8-Mbit SPI Serial Flash Memory Device SST25LF080A 8-Mbit Serial
Flash Product Features High-Clock Frequency in an 8-Lead SOIC
Package SUNNYVALE, Calif., April 26 /PRNewswire-FirstCall/ -- SST
(Silicon Storage Technology, Inc.) , a leader in flash memory
technology, today announced production availability of its 8-Mbit
Serial Peripheral Interface (SPI) serial flash memory device, the
SST25LF080A. Based on SST's proprietary, high-performance
SuperFlash technology, the SST25LF080A is the latest addition to
the successful 25 Series of serial flash memory products. Ideal for
such applications as hard disk drives, printers, security systems,
industrial controls, 802.11a/b/g and wired networking equipment,
SST's 8-Mbit serial flash device features a 33-MHz max clock
frequency and a typical standby current of only 8 microamperes,
thus significantly improving performance while lowering power
consumption. The 33-MHz clock frequency has also been extended to
SST's 2-Mbit and 4-Mbit serial flash devices, which are also
currently available in volume production. The company expects to
add the 33-MHz speed option to the 1-Mbit and 512-Kbit serial flash
devices in the second half of 2004. SST's 8-Mbit serial flash
device offers several advantages not available in alternative
solutions, including an Auto Address Increment (AAI) operation and
small sector erase capability. The 8-Mbit serial flash memory
device is offered in a small footprint, 8-pin SOIC package with 200

migration." SST's serial flash memory products incorporate a
four-wire, SPI-compatible interface. When compared to other
nonvolatile memory interfaces, the SPI- interface serial flash
products use fewer pins to transfer data to and from a system CPU,
thereby creating an overall reduction in board space, power
consumption and cost. Like all of SST's products based on
SuperFlash technology, the SST25LF080A features small sector erase
capability, allowing designers to seamlessly partition code or data
into 4-KByte sectors, resulting in faster write times and an
overall increase in system performance. Because of its low power
consumption and small footprint, the SST25LF080A is an ideal code
storage solution in applications such as hard disk drives, wireless
and networking equipment. SST's 8-Mbit serial flash memory devices
feature a unique AAI fast- programming mode, enabling a reduction
in total flash memory programming time by up to 50 percent when
compared to single-byte programming modes. The AAI program
instruction allows multiple bytes of serial flash memory to be
programmed without re-issuing subsequent addresses and commands
after the first data byte program sequence. As a result, new
programs can be loaded into flash using fewer commands, thus
reducing programming times. This advantage is especially useful
during the manufacturing process, where fast production line
throughput is essential. SST's 25 Series of serial flash memory
products range in density from 512 Kbit to 16 Mbit, all containing
the same footprint, providing customers with a seamless migration
path to higher densities for their systems. This capability allows
designers to create product lines with new levels of functional
flexibility and dramatically lower system costs when compared to
systems using parallel flash products housed in traditional 32-pin

About SuperFlash Technology SST's SuperFlash technology is a NOR
type, split-gate cell architecture which uses a reliable
thick-oxide process with fewer manufacturing steps resulting in a
low-cost, nonvolatile memory solution with excellent data retention
and higher reliability. The split-gate NOR SuperFlash architecture
facilitates a simple and flexible design suitable for high
performance, high reliability, small or medium sector size, in- or
off-system programming and a variety of densities, all in a single
CMOS-compatible technology. About Silicon Storage Technology, Inc.

Key Features of The SST25LF080A Serial Flash Product -- Low Power
Consumption -- Active current: 7 milliamperes (typical) -- Standby
current: 8 microamperes (typical) -- Small Footprint -- 8-pin SOIC
(200 mils body width) -- Fast Erase and Byte-Program -- Chip-erase
time: 70 milliseconds (typical) -- Sector- or block-erase time: 18
milliseconds (typical) -- Byte-program time: 14 microseconds
(typical) -- Superior Reliability with SST's SuperFlash Technology
-- 100,000 cycles endurance (typical) and greater than 100 years of
data retention -- Flexible Erase Capability -- Uniform 4-KByte
sectors -- Uniform 32-KByte overlay blocks -- Serial Interface
Architecture -- SPI compatible: Mode 0 and Mode 3 -- Auto Address
Increment (AAI) Programming for Fast Production Throughput --
33-MHz Max Clock Frequency -- Single 3.0V-3.6V Read and Write
Operation -- Hardware Write Protection Through WP# -- Software
Write Protection Through Block-Protection bits in Status Register
-- End-of-Write Detection -- Hold Pin (HOLD#) -- Temperature Range
-- Industrial: -40 degrees Celsius to +85 degrees Celsius For More
